The Graduate Record Examination

The Graduate Record Examination, or GRE, is an important step in the graduate school or business school application process. The GRE is a multiple-choice, computer-based, standardized exam that is often required for admission to graduate programs and graduate business programs (MBA) globally.
The paper-delivered GRE® General Test takes up to 3 hours and 30 minutes and consists of three separately timed sections: Verbal Reasoning — There are two 35-minute sections, each containing 25 questions. Quantitative Reasoning — There are two 40-minute sections, each containing 25 questions.
